Low-Income Energy Assistance Program (LEAP)


Agency : Broomfield Health and Human Services Department
Location: 100 Spader Way - Broomfield County
Description:

The Low-Income Energy Assistance Program (LEAP) is a federally funded program designed to help qualifying low-income households pay for a portion of their winter home heating costs. LEAP is available from November 1st - April 30th and may only be used once per heating season. LEAP payments are given directly to the heating fuel vendor or placed on a QUEST card to pay for heating sources, such as:

  • Wood
  • Coal
  • Propane
  • Heat billed on a shared meter

Eligibility:

Applicants must:

  • Be a permanent legal resident of the United States and Colorado, or have a household member that is a US citizen
  • Pay home heating costs to a heating provider, fuel dealer, or landlord as part of rent
  • Have a maximum household income that falls within the guidelines below

'Household” means people who live with you and for whom you are financially responsible.

Household Size Monthly Gross Income for the 2022-2023 Season

60% of State Median Income

1 - $2,880

2 - $3,766

3 - $4,652

4 - $5,539

5 - $6,425

6 - $7,311

7 - $7,477

8 - $7,644

Each Additional Person $166

Area Served: Broomfield County
Application Process: Applications are accepted November 1st - April 30th. Apply online at coloradopeak.secure.force.com. Visit the website to download a paper application and drop off at the local DHS office, or mail/email to the county to process. Call to request a mailed paper application, apply over the phone, or for more information.
